Democratic congresswomen Elaine Luria, Abigail Spanberger and Jennifer Wexton faced stiff competition from Republicans in their reelection bids.
All eight other Virginia members of the U.S. House are up for reelection as well, though incumbents in those seatsRepublicans in each of the competitive Virginia districts largely framed the race as a referendum on President Biden and the economy, repeatedly decrying record-high inflation and high government spending in Washington, while tying their opponents to Biden and House Speaker Nancy Pelosi .
“Things are bad in this country,” said Bernard Traud, a Navy veteran who came with his wife to vote for Kiggans. “What we got ain’t working.” His wife, Cheryl Traud, ticked off a litany of reasons to vote for the Republican. “I’m tired of the mess,” she said. “I’m tired of what’s going on in schools. I’m tired of the border. I’m tired of the economy. I’m tired of the fuel state we’re in. And I’m tired of this guy sitting up there trying to pick a war with everyone.
Brittany Asbury, 35, said “if you do not know basic biological functions, that would make you someone I wouldn’t vote for on principle.” But Tim McTaggart, 66, said the higher cost of living fueled his vote for Spanberger. “Spanberger can get the job done,” McTaggart said. “Vega is way out there.” He wasn’t swayed by Republican messaging that the inflation was Democrats’ fault, and his reasoning was simple: The economy isn’t something Congress can control, he said. “There’s more to it than just Democratic or Republican policies.”
